body {
      font-weight: normal; 
      font-size: 85%; 
      font-family: Arial, Helvetica, sans-serif; 
      color: black;
      }

h1 {font-weight: bold; font-size: 150%; margin-bottom: 0.2em;} 
h2 {font-weight: bold; font-size: 130%; margin-top: 0.9em; margin-bottom: 0; padding-bottom: 0;} 
h2.center {font-weight: bold; font-size: 150%; text-align: center; margin-bottom: 0; padding-bottom: 0;} 
h3 {font-weight: bold; font-size: 95%; margin-bottom: 0; padding-bottom: 0;} 

p {font-weight: normal; font-size: 85%;}
p.tighten {font-weight: normal; font-size: 85%; margin-top: 0;}

.regcontent {font-weight: normal; font-size: 85%;}
.directorycontent  {font-weight: normal; font-size: 78%;}
.caption {font-weight: normal; font-size: 65%;}



.sidebar {font-size: 75%; font-family: Arial, Helvetica, sans-serif; color: white; }

a.sidebar:link { color: white; font-size: 75%; font-family: Arial, Helvetica, sans-serif; }
a.sidebar:visited { color: white; font-size: 75%; font-family: Arial, Helvetica, sans-serif; }
a.sidebar:hover { color: yellow; font-size: 75%; font-family: Arial, Helvetica, sans-serif; }
a.sidebar:active { color: yellow; font-size: 75%; font-family: Arial, Helvetica, sans-serif; }


.footer1 {font-weight: normal; font-size: 80%; font-family: Arial, Helvetica, sans-serif; color: white; }

a.footer1:link { color: white;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
a.footer1:visited { color: white;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
a.footer1:hover { color: yellow;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
a.footer1:active { color: yellow;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}

a.footer2:link { color: #d5c7ba;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
a.footer2:visited { color: #d5c7ba;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
a.footer2:hover { color: yellow;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}
a.footer2:active { color: yellow; font-size: 80%; font-family: Arial, Helvetica, sans-serif; }

a:link { color: black;  font-family: Arial, Helvetica, sans-serif;}
a:visited { color: black;  font-family: Arial, Helvetica, sans-serif;}
a:hover { color: red;  font-family: Arial, Helvetica, sans-serif;}
a:active { color: red;  font-family: Arial, Helvetica, sans-serif;}

a.nav:link { color: #d5c7ba; font-size: 85%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none;}
a.nav:visited { color: #d5c7ba; font-size: 85%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none;}
a.nav:hover { color: yellow; font-size: 95%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none;}
a.nav:active { color: yellow; font-size: 95%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none;}

.nav {display: block;
      padding: 5px 8px 5px 8px;}

a.navHere:link { color: black; font-size: 100%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none; font-weight: bold;}
a.navHere:visited { color: black; font-size: 100%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none; font-weight: bold;}
a.navHere:hover { color: black; font-size: 100%; font-family: Arial, Helvetica, sans-serif;  text-decoration: none; font-weight: bold;}
a.navHere:active { color: black; font-size: 100%; font-family: Arial, Helvetica, sans-serif; text-decoration: none; font-weight: bold;}

.navHere {display: block;
          padding: 5px 10px 5px 10px;}

a.menu:link { color: #d5c7ba; font-size: 75%; text-decoration: none;}
a.menu:visited { color: #d5c7ba; font-size: 75%; text-decoration: none;}
a.menu:hover { color: yellow; font-size: 80%; text-decoration: none; font-weight: bold;}
a.menu:active { color: yellow; font-size: 80%; text-decoration: none; font-weight: bold;}

.menu {display: block;
       padding: 5 10px 5px 10px;
       border-bottom: 1px solid #b3a08f;}

a.menuHere:link { color: yellow; font-size: 80%; text-decoration: none; font-weight: bold;}
a.menuHere:visited { color: yellow; font-size: 80%; text-decoration: none; font-weight: bold;}
a.menuHere:hover { color: yellow; font-size: 80%; text-decoration: none; font-weight: bold;}
a.menuHere:active { color: yellow; font-size: 80%; text-decoration: none; font-weight: bold;}

.menuHere {display: block;
       padding: 5 10px 5px 10px;
       border-bottom: 1px solid #b3a08f;}
